![]() Four modifications are the grouping of terms and phrases in the domains of specifications, testing, qualification, and validation. Acronyms are expanded at the beginning of each alphabetical section and defined with the full term or phrase. Acronyms are grouped at the beginning of each alphabetical section, and are followed by words, terms and phrases. The organization of this document is primarily alphabetical. It is also a resource for investigators who conduct inspections and investigations involving software and computerized systems. It will facilitate consistency in describing the requirements of the law and regulations applicable to such products and systems. This document is intended to serve as a glossary of terminology applicable to software development and computerized systems in FDA regulated industries. The document does not bind FDA, and does no confer any rights, privileges, benefits, or immunities for or on any person(s). Note: This document is reference material for investigators and other FDA personnel. ![]()
